当先锋百科网

首页 1 2 3 4 5 6 7

jQuery是一种流行的JavaScript库,它可以使JavaScript的代码变得更加简洁、灵活。其中一个最常用的方法是$( ),这个方法有很多含义,接下来我们分别来看。

$(document).ready(function(){
// do something after the DOM is ready
});

第一个含义是用来确保DOM文档加载完成后执行某些JavaScript代码。这个方法使用了一个回调函数,当整个HTML页面被解析完毕后,DOM文档就准备好了。这时候,回调函数内的代码就可以正常执行了。

$('p').addClass('highlight');

第二个含义是用来修改HTML元素的样式类,比如为一个段落添加highlight样式。在这个例子中,$('p')会选中所有的段落元素,并向它们添加一个highlight样式。

$('#myForm').submit(function(event){
// prevent form from submitting and handle data here
event.preventDefault();
});

第三个含义是用来监听某些事件,比如在表单提交时执行一些JavaScript代码,而不是刷新整个页面。在这个例子中,$('#myForm')监听了表单的submit事件,并且在事件发生时执行了回调函数。同时,event.preventDefault()会阻止HTML表单默认的刷新行为。

$.get('data.json', function(data){
// process data from server
});

最后一个含义是用来从服务器获取数据。在这个例子中,$.get()方法会向服务器请求data.json文件,并在获取数据后调用回调函数处理数据。这使得我们可以在不刷新整个页面的情况下更新页面内容,提高了用户的体验。